You are very likely to run across the Amish driving their buggiesĭown the road anywhere in La Plata as they go about their daily errands. Produced by the Amish community such as the bakery and butcher shop, while others like the Country Variety Store also feature itemsįrom the non-Amish world that are needed in the Amish community. Some of these shops features goods almost exclusively Bring cash as the Amish do not take charge cards. But you are definitely welcome to visit and purchase The stores listed below are not where Amish offer their goods to the non-Amish public,īut rather are the stores where the Amish themselves shop for their own needs.
While there are no Amish tourist attractions in the region, you are welcome to visit the Amish stores and carefully drive theīack roads that pass by many Amish farms.
